**Ticket ELV-88: Signature verification failure on Hoistline build 412**

Build 412 of the Hoistline elevator-dispatch simulator failed signature verification on the staging runner. Cause: the contractor machine still has the retired key cached. Fix: clear `~/.hoistline/keys`, re-import, rebuild. Do not bypass verification with `--no-verify`; staging will reject the artifact anyway. Dispatch model binaries and car-scheduling tables are both covered by the same check. The current valid signing key is below.

release key, yagap-kagag: bky6_1ks93y

**14:22 — Quota enforcement restored.** After the Brindlehop gateway redeploy, per-tenant rate quotas were re-seeded from the Oakmere config snapshot taken at 13:05. Tenants previously throttled at the default ceiling were verified against their contracted limits by the on-call pair. The deploy that carried the corrected quota table is identified by the trace token below.

build token for fajof-yahof: htk4_869f

**Q: Do the Lanternkit Swift and Kotlin SDKs have feature parity?**

Mostly. Offline caching and retry policies match as of the Meridian release, but the Kotlin SDK still lacks streaming uploads. For the weekly eng sync: parity tracking lives in the Lanternkit matrix doc. To unlock the parity test vault, use the recovery passphrase below.

vault phrase of kawep-tahog = ulaix-briath

Known issue. Thornquist gateway drops websocket sessions after ~30 min idle. Old clients reconnected without re-authenticating, briefly holding stale session state. Patched in v1.9: reconnects now force a full handshake. Security-relevant points: stale sessions were read-only, scoped to the original tenant, never crossed the Marrowfield boundary. Audit logs capture every reconnect event. To reproduce or verify the fix, hit the staging gateway directly. Staging auth uses the internal service key below.

gateway credential: kto23_LX9A4ys6i4nzHtpOLNLodKK